The Role of Random Number Generators (RNGs)
At the heart of this type of game lies a sophisticated Random Number Generator (RNG). The RNG is a complex algorithm that produces a sequence of numbers that appear random. These numbers determine the multiplier at each stage of the game and, ultimately, the point at which the aircraft crashes. Reputable gaming providers subject their RNGs to rigorous testing by independent auditing firms to ensure fairness and transparency. These audits verify that the RNG is truly random and that the game is not rigged in any way. Understanding the role of the RNG is crucial for dispelling any misconceptions about the game’s fairness.
The RNG operates continuously, generating numbers even when no one is playing. This ensures that each round is independent of the previous ones and that the outcome is completely unpredictable. It’s important to note that the RNG doesn’t “remember” past results, so attempting to predict future crashes based on historical data is largely futile. The RNG is a mathematical certainty, and any perceived patterns are likely due to chance rather than any inherent predictability.

Psychological Factors in Gameplay
The psychology of this game is fascinating and often underestimated. The constant upward movement of the plane triggers a sense of anticipation and excitement, while the potential for a sudden crash creates a feeling of anxiety. These emotions can cloud judgment and lead to impulsive decisions. The “near miss” effect, where the plane climbs to a high multiplier without crashing, can be particularly addictive, reinforcing the belief that a large win is just around the corner. It is important to be aware of these psychological biases and to maintain a rational mindset.
The “gambler’s fallacy,” the belief that past events influence future outcomes in a random process, is also common in this type of game. Players may believe that a crash is “due” after a long streak of successful flights, or that a high multiplier is “more likely” after a series of small wins. This belief is, of course, false, but it can lead to irrational betting decisions. Recognizing and acknowledging these psychological traps is crucial for making informed choices and avoiding costly mistakes.

Exploring Advanced Betting Techniques
Beyond basic strategies, some players delve into more advanced techniques. These often involve complex combinations of bets, utilizing automated betting tools, or analyzing large datasets of historical results. Martingale systems, where bets are doubled after each loss in an attempt to recoup previous losses, are popular, but incredibly risky, and can quickly deplete a bankroll. Reverse Martingale systems, increasing bets after wins, can offer more controlled gains but still carry inherent risks. The effectiveness of these techniques is debatable, and they require a thorough understanding of the game's mechanics and a high degree of risk tolerance.
Another advanced technique involves using "auto-cash out" features, where a pre-determined multiplier is set, and the bet automatically cashes out when that multiplier is reached. This can help to remove emotional decision-making from the process and ensure that profits are secured. However, it's important to carefully consider the multiplier level, as setting it too low may result in missed opportunities, while setting it too high may lead to a crash before the cash out is triggered. Combining these advanced strategies with sound bankroll management is crucial for mitigating risk.
